Flat 8, Brackley Court, 40 Longley Lane, Manchester, M22 4JJ is a leasehold flat built between 1967-1975. The property offers approximately 732 square feet of living space and is situated on the 1st floor. In this location, apartments of similar size usually have two bedrooms.

The estimated current market value of the property is £178,129 , which equates to approximately £243 per square foot. It was last sold on 1 Sep 2017 for £125,000. Since then, the value has increased by £53,129, representing a 42.5% increase, or approximately 5.1% per year.

Flat 8, Brackley Court, 40 Longley Lane, Manchester, Greater Manchester, M22 4JJ has an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) rating of E, based on the latest assessment carried out on 25 Jul 2012.

This property uses electric storage heaters as its main heating source. Hot water is provided from off-peak electric immersion heater. The windows are fully double glazed.

The previous EPC assessment was conducted on 28 Apr 2010, when the property was rated F. Since then, the rating has improved to E, with the energy efficiency score increasing by 123.8%.

Since the previous assessment, several changes were observed:

  • The main heating energy efficiency improving from very poor to average, while the heating system type remained the same (electric storage heaters).
  • The hot water energy efficiency changing from very good to average, while the system remained as electric immersion, off-peak.
  • The wall construction or insulation changed from cavity wall, filled cavity to cavity wall, as built, no insulation (assumed), changing energy efficiency from good to poor.
  • The lighting was updated from low energy lighting in all fixed outlets to no low energy lighting, with efficiency changing from very good to very poor.
